Cd/DVD drive not listed anywhere.
I do not have the dvd/cd drive listed in the device manager. the drive spools up and acts like it is reading.
The first thing to check is whether you can boot from the drive. Do you have a recovery disk or other bootable cd or dvd? If so, try it and if it can boot you know 100% the problem is software and not hardware. If it cannot boot it is hardware.
If you do not have a bootable disk or do not know how to use one, then the next thing to try is the registry edits to remove upper and lower filters. There is a Microsoft autofix linked here:

my dvd drive not recognized in device manager,getting the yellow explanation mark. Tried uninstallingdevice drive and scanning for new hardware. scanned for updates, etc. I getting no results. The laptop is a Pavilion DV5. Thanks
Hi,
It could be that the drive has a Hardware issue, but try the following.
From the Start Menu, open All Programs, open Accessories, right click the Command Prompt and select 'Run as Administrator'. In to the prompt type the following command and hit enter.
sfc /scannow ( note that there is a space between sfc and the / )
Let the process complete, then type exit and hit enter.
Next, open Device Manager, right click the DVD drive and select Uninstall. When this has completed, restart the notebook and let Windows rediscover the device and check.

EMac External LACIE DVD Drive not reading.
eMac External LACIE DVD Drive not reading.
eMac 700 MHz running OS X 4.4
Came without DVD or modem internal
Has 256mb memory
Bought a used Lacie 1394 Firewire DVR External.
Was able to burn DVD’s and CD’s with Toast 6 Light.
Cannot find the “DVD Player” on the hard drive.
It will read data DVD.
eMac will not read any movies burnt or bought.
I was told I probably need more memory?
Thought running IDVD would fix the problem.
No Soap.
This machine was giving external modem problems before Tiger was installed.
Before we spend more money or just get ride of the eMac.
What is the DVD problem?
This same Lacie burner reads and writes DVD and CD fine with our iMac 450 DV 320mb memory. Running 9.2 and X.3OS X 10.3.x / 10.4.x natively support data burning to external DVD drives but video payback requires software such as iDVD which isn't installed by default on models without an internal DVD drive (the installer sees no internal drive and thinks it's unnecessary). Try downloading VLC Player and see if that will let you play movies.
